Who is Bath's Brainiest Business?

Julian House is inviting the big brains from local companies to compete in winning the coveted trophy, at their festive quiz, The Brain of Bath.

On Thursday 27th November up to 30 teams will battle it out in this fun and competitive quiz event to see which team has what it takes to claim the title.

The popular quiz will see teams compete during ten rounds of challenging and fun questions at the Bath Pavilion. Rounds include a variety of tricky topics including the now infamous 'What's That Smell?' round.

The entry fee also includes a light supper with a cash bar available on the night. For smaller companies, half table bookings are available, and you will be team up with another company on the night.

Bath is operating a charging Clean Air Zone. Owners of all higher emission vehicles – except private cars and motorbikes – will need to pay to drive in the city centre. To check if you need to pay or to apply for an exemption or discount, go to bathnes.gov.uk/BathCAZ
